List opp grunnleggende datatyper som er tilgjengelige i Visual Basic

Grunnleggende datatyper, noen ganger referert til som enkle typer eller primitiver, danner noen av de skalare forhåndsdefinerte typer i Visual Basic. Du kan bruke disse datatypene umiddelbart i programmene i beregninger, datalagring eller for å bygge høyere nivå datatyper. Noen av de grunnleggende talltypene har unike signerte og usignerte versjoner: signert typer kan holde positive eller negative verdier mens usignerte typer kan holde bare positive verdier.

Integers

Visual Basic har flere numeriske datatyper, blant annet signerte typer sbyte, kort, heltall og lang, og deres usignert ekvivalenter byte, ushort, uinteger og ULONG. De byte og sbyte typer holde en byte av data hver, de korte og ushort typer holde to bytes, heltallet og uinteger typer holder fire og de lange og ULONG typer holder åtte. For å spare plass i minnet, bruker de riktige datatyper når du vet rekkevidden og signere dine variabler vil ha. For eksempel bruke heltall type hvis den variable kan ha verdier mellom -32 768 og 32 767.

Flyttall

De enkle, doble og desimaltall datatyper arbeidet mye som hele nummeret heltall, men de tillater deg å inkludere desimaler i beregningene. Singelen er en fire-byte type, dobbel en åtte-byte type og desimaltall typer inneholde opptil 16 byte. Desimaltall typer kan ha opp til 28 desimaler. Alle tre typer kan ha positive eller negative verdier, og ikke har unike signerte og usignerte typer. Bruk flytdatatyper når du trenger nøyaktige beregninger.

Tegn

Røye datatype har en enkelt to-byte tegn. Strengen typen har en variabel lengde og kan ta omtrent to milliarder tegn. Bruk røye typer når du trenger bare en tegn-variabler, for eksempel når en bruker fyller ut en multiple-choice quiz. Bruk strenger når du trenger å lagre mer informasjon, for eksempel brukerens navn eller lengre inndata. Du kan opprette en rekke røye typer som fungerer som en enkelt streng, men dette innebærer mer overhead i beregninger og streng manipulasjon.

boolsk

Boolske datatyper holde enkle sanne eller falske verdier. Standardverdien er falsk. Bruk disse to statene til å teste forholdene eller sjekk om ulike deler av programmet er aktive eller ikke. For eksempel, hvis programmet krever en bruker å legge inn noen data før du fortsetter, vil du bruke en boolsk variabel satt til false inntil brukeren tilfredsstiller kravet, og da du endre tilstanden til sann.

Dato

Datoen grunnleggende datatype har en åtte-byte verdi varierende fra 1. januar 0001 til 31. desember 9999. Det kan også holde tidsverdier fra 00:00:00 til 11: 59: 9999999 pm Du må legge ved datoverdier i antall skilter. Formatet for dato typer er # M / d / åååå # og #HH: MM: SS PM # for 12-timers ganger eller #HH: MM: SS # for 24-timers ganger. Du kan også sette en dato og tid i en variabel ved å kapsle hele strengen i talltegn.